RAF blogs give recruits real insight (New Media Zero)
The RAF is using podcasts, blogs, online videos and interactive roleplays to attract new recruits into its ranks. The initiative is aimed at giving future recruits an insight into what being in the armed forces is really like.

NEW ENTERTAINMENT, PREP FOOTBALL BLOGS LAUNCHED (News Journal)
We have launched two new reader-interactive blogs on the News Journal Web site. One blog deals with local entertainment information and is moderated by News Journal entertainment writer Norm Narvaja. The other is on area high school football and is moderated by prep football beat writer Curt Conrad.
Blogs reveal painful recoveries of London bombing survivors (Pittsburgh Post-Gazette)
LONDON -- Bloodied and bewildered strangers led each other from the wreckage of the London bombings last July 7. A year later, many of them have forged close bonds -- sharing their experiences in a network of blogs.
